Как найти значения lat long из ТОЧКИ - PullRequest
1 голос
/ 29 ноября 2010

У меня есть значение Point, равное POINT (24,3 80,2), которое хранится в переменной pnt

Я хочу иметь значения lat и long отдельно. Есть ли простой способ получить это с помощью Python

POINT - это географическое положение, которое означает POINT (широта и долгота)

1 Ответ

5 голосов
/ 29 ноября 2010

[Редактировать: Игнасио Васкес-Абрамс на месте!]

Вы используете geos django.

Ознакомьтесь с документами .

>>> pnt = Point(5, 23)
>>> [coord for coord in pnt]
[5.0, 23.0]
>>> pnt.coords
(5.0, 23.0)

Следующее не имеет значения, но может использоваться.Сохранено для других ссылок.

Проверьте следующий проект: pyproj

Модуль может выполнять картографические преобразования и геодезические вычисления.

Класс Proj может преобразовывать географические (долгота, широта) в собственные координаты проекции карты (x, y) и наоборот, или изодна система координат проекции карты непосредственно на другую.

и многое другое.

Также проверьте: geojson

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...